Pvt. Tobias Completes Training FORT POLK, LA. - Army private first class Richard E. Tobias, 22, son of Mr. and Mrs. Charles W. Tobias, 601 S. Madison, Nappanee, completed today nine weeks of advanced individual infantry training at Fort Polk, La. During the course, he received guerrilla training and lived under simulated Viet Nam conditions for five days, fighting off night attacks and conducting raids on enemy villages. He was taught methods of removing booby traps, setting ambushes and avoiding enemy ambushes. Other specialized training* included small unit tactics, map reading, land mine warfare* communications, and firing the M-16 rifle. M-60 machine gun and the 3.5-inch rocket launcher Pvt. Tobias served with Company A. 2D Battalion of the 3D Brigade. The private, whose wife, Eugenia, lives at 2001 N. Walnut, Muncie, is a 1967 graduate of Nappanee high school and received a bachelor of science degree in 1971 from' Ball State university at Muncie. Jehovah Assembly Set For March The Indiana circuit five circuit Assembly of Jehovah’s Witnesses will hold it’s opening session at 6:45 pm. on March 17 at the Lincoln junior high school, r Logansport, and continue through March 19. There will be three days of advanced ministerial training, intensive Bible instruction and Christian fellowship plus visits to homes of local residents to answer questions. To date, 1,800 persons are expected to attend the assembly from North-Central Indiana. Theme to be used is “Conscious of Our Spiritual Need” from Matthew 5:3.
